Nucor is North America's largest recycler and most diversified steel and steel products company. Since 1969, we have led the industry in developing innovative technologies for recycling scrap into high-quality steels that are all around us, from bridges and buildings to cars and appliances.
This position serves as a vital link in our daily operations, ensuring the seamless flow of materials and the safety of our team. As a Lead, you will be responsible for running and maintaining day-to-day yard activities, requiring a flexible approach to a dynamic work environment. You will operate heavy equipment of various sizes and weights, including loaders, cranes, and forklifts, while performing daily material testing to ensure quality standards are met.
Safety is the cornerstone of our culture and the most important part of all jobs within Nucor. In this role, you will initiate, lead, and uphold safety policies, practices, and housekeeping standards at all times. You will be responsible for reporting any unsafe acts or safety deficiencies to the Supervisor and Facility Manager, ensuring full compliance across the team.
Beyond technical operations, you will act as a professional communicator with all employees. This includes maintaining confidentiality when working with yard personnel and administering breaks and lunches to ensure production goals are met without interruption. You will also manage equipment operations from start-up to shut-down and maintain an organized inventory of parts.
